sources coupons directly from merchants and may earn a commission when you buy through links on our site. Terms of Service

life extension (1)

Life extension refers to the scientific pursuit of prolonging human life and enhancing its quality through various means, including medical advancements, lifestyle changes, and technological innovations.

Visit Store